How to Apply to the Reconstructive and Prosthetic Urology Fellowship
Prerequisite/Eligibility Requirements
Fellowship selection is performed through the GURS Match.
www.societygurs.org
Requirements
- Applicant should be able to obtain full medical license from the state of Pennsylvania at the time of initiation of the fellowship.
- Current CV
- Applicant should have completed all steps of the USMLE
- Applicant must have 3 supporting letters of recommendation (one letter must be from Chair or program director)
- Admission is contingent upon completion of an ACGME accredited urologic training program or a similar training program from outside the United States.
